Drama, Theatre and Performance BA (Hons) is an undergraduate degree at University of Sussex, based in Brighton, taught full-time over 3 years. Graduates earn £22,000 on average 15 months after finishing. Typical A-level entry is BBB.

About this course

About the course

Drama, theatre and performance can transform how we think, act and understand the world. They help us remember the past, change the present and imagine alternative futures.

This course is for you if you’d like to:

- expand your mind about drama, theatre and performance

- collaborate with others passionate about making performance

- develop the confidence to present and reflect on your work in public contexts.

Site-specific theatre, live art, durational performance, contemporary playwriting, choreography and composition, visual arts, creative writing, acting and directing – you’ll learn from tutors who bring their passion to their teaching. Our campus facilities include the Attenborough Centre for the Creative Arts, which hosts professional theatre, music and dance by UK and international companies. We’re committed to antiracist pedagogy, and inclusive teaching and learning. Throughout your degree, you’ll:

- explore performance-making from multiple perspectives

- develop skills in collaboration, critical and creative writing, and independent research

- complete practical presentations and performance projects with focused tutor support

- experience guest artist workshops, talks and performances from internationally recognised industry professionals

- take electives from other subjects – from business to law and modern languages – to open your mind to other disciplines and tailor your degree to your interests.

When you graduate, you’ll be curious, critically informed and self-reflective. You’ll be able to make sophisticated performance, and shape cogent arguments in written work and discussion. Your skills as a critical thinker, creative practitioner and knowledgeable researcher will set you up for your future career.
